Poetry Practice--Emily Dickinson

Read the following poem by Emily Dickinson; identify the techniques used.

Much madness is Divinest Sense--
To a discerning Eye--
Much Sense the starkest Madness--
'Tis the Majority
In this, as All, prevail--
Assent--and you are sane--
Demur--you're straightway dangerous
And handled with a Chain--
